मेरे माउस व्हील ने काम करना बंद कर दिया है। जब यह काम करता है तो यह ऊपर और नीचे स्क्रॉल नहीं करता है। मैं कैसे कॉन्फ़िगर कर सकता हूं कि माउस का प्रत्येक बटन क्या करता है? मैं Ubuntu 10.10 का उपयोग करता हूं।
मेरे माउस व्हील ने काम करना बंद कर दिया है। जब यह काम करता है तो यह ऊपर और नीचे स्क्रॉल नहीं करता है। मैं कैसे कॉन्फ़िगर कर सकता हूं कि माउस का प्रत्येक बटन क्या करता है? मैं Ubuntu 10.10 का उपयोग करता हूं।
जवाबों:
मैं कैसे कॉन्फ़िगर कर सकता हूं कि माउस का प्रत्येक बटन क्या करता है?
यदि आपका हार्डवेयर चल रहा है, तो आप जांच कर सकते हैं xev
। एप्लिकेशन के माध्यम से एक टर्मिनल खोलें → सहायक उपकरण → टर्मिनल और प्रकार xev
। एक छोटी सफेद खिड़की दिखाई देनी चाहिए। जब आप अपना कर्सर उस विंडो में ले जाते हैं, तो कमांड लाइन आउटपुट आपको बताएगा कि आपका माउस क्या कर रहा है।
Button 4
इस उदाहरण में ऊपर स्क्रॉल करने के लिए संदर्भित करता है। यदि आपको स्क्रॉल करते समय कोई आउटपुट नहीं मिलता है, तो हो सकता है कि आपका माउस बस टूट गया हो।
इसका परीक्षण करते समय, कृपया अपने माउस के इर्द-गिर्द घूमने वाले आउटपुट को अनदेखा करें।
यदि आप जानते हैं कि आपका माउस टूटा नहीं है, और xev अभी भी आपको स्क्रॉल व्हील का कोई संकेत नहीं देता है - उदाहरण के लिए यदि माउस दूसरे कंप्यूटर पर काम करता है, तो आप बग का अनुभव कर रहे हैं । इस मामले में, Ubuntu विकी के लेख पढ़ें कि कैसे बग की रिपोर्ट करें और इसे X.org के खिलाफ दर्ज करें । अपनी बग रिपोर्ट में सभी विवरणों को शामिल करना सुनिश्चित करें, साथ ही त्रुटि को कैसे पुन: पेश करें।
यह निश्चित करें कि आपका माउस बग दर्ज करने से पहले काम करता है।
मैं कैसे कॉन्फ़िगर कर सकता हूं कि माउस का प्रत्येक बटन क्या करता है?
आप अपने माउस बटन को फिर से असाइन करने के लिए btnx का उपयोग कर सकते हैं । यह तभी काम करेगा जब उनका सही तरीके से पता लगाया जाएगा।
कार्यक्रम उन्हें कॉन्फ़िगर करने के लिए आपके प्रत्येक बटन के माध्यम से जाने के लिए कहेगा। नोट: यदि xev
स्क्रॉल इच्छा को मान्यता नहीं देता है, तो यह प्रोग्राम इसे पहचान नहीं पाएगा।
मैं एक Logitech M510 वायरलेस ब्लूटूथ माउस का उपयोग कर रहा था और उबंटू 18.04 के साथ इस मुद्दे का अनुभव कर रहा था। मैंने देखा कि xev स्क्रॉल के लिए किसी भी घटना का पता नहीं लगा रहा था। अपने मुद्दे को हल करने के लिए, मैंने माउस को बंद कर दिया और फिर इसे वापस चालू किया और यह काम किया।
पुराना धागा, लेकिन उपरोक्त में से कोई भी मेरे लिए काम नहीं किया।
यही काम किया। प्रेषक: https://ubuntuforums.org/showthread.php?t=1750708
मैं अपने PS / 2 माउस पर काम करने वाले स्क्रॉल व्हील को प्राप्त करने में कामयाब रहा। जहाँ तक मुझे पता है, यह तकनीक केवल PS / 2 माउस पर काम करेगी।
जैसा कि मैं बता सकता हूं, उबंटू "सामान्य" चूहों के रूप में कुछ पीएस / 2 चूहों का पता लगाता है; यह है, केवल दो बटन होने और वह यह है।
मुझे अपने माउस का इलाज करने के लिए कर्नेल को Microsoft Intellimouse के रूप में काम करने के लिए मजबूर करना पड़ा, जिससे कि स्क्रॉल व्हील काम कर सके। इसे सत्यापित करने के लिए, /var/log/Xorg.0.log को देखें और देखें कि क्या कुछ पंक्तियाँ "PS / 2 जेनरिक माउस" का संदर्भ दे रही हैं।
चेतावनी: निम्न आदेश आपके GRUB कॉन्फ़िगरेशन को बदलते हैं, और उबंटू या अन्य OS के unbootable को बोधगम्य रूप से प्रस्तुत कर सकते हैं।
एक टर्मिनल खोलें, और टाइप करें:
sudo nano /etc/default/grub
नैनो में, एक लाइन के साथ शुरू होता है:
GRUB_CMDLINE_LINUX_DEFAULT =
इस पंक्ति का अनुसरण उद्धरणों में कुछ पाठ होगा।
लाइन में "psmouse.proto = imps" डालें, ताकि पूरी चीज़ कुछ इस तरह दिखे:
GRUB_CMDLINE_LINUX_DEFAULT="psmouse.proto=imps quiet nosplash"
फिर बाहर निकलने के लिए CTRL-X को हिट करें, फिर अपने परिवर्तनों को बचाने के लिए Y।
फिर आपको टाइप करना होगा:
कोड:
sudo update-grub
अपने बूट मेनू को अपडेट करने के लिए। फिर आपको एक कार्यात्मक स्क्रॉल व्हील को रिबूट करने और आनंद लेने में सक्षम होना चाहिए। इसके अतिरिक्त, /var/log/Xorg.0.log को अब अपने माउस को "ImPS / 2 जेनेरिक व्हील माउस" के रूप में पहचानना चाहिए।